Aragarcas vs Encruz. Do Sul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Aragarcas, Brazil and Encruz. Do Sul, Brazil is approximately 1,627 km or 1,011 mi.
  • To reach Aragarcas in this distance one would set out from Encruz. Do Sul bearing 1.1°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Aragarcas bearing 1° or N .
  • Aragarcas has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Encruz. Do Sul has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Aragarcas is in or near the tropical dry forest biome whereas Encruz. Do Sul is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 7.4 °C (13.3°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 7.6 °C (13.7°F) less in Aragarcas.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 33.4 mm (1.3 in) more which is equivalent to 33.4 l/m² (0.82 US gal/ft²) or 334,000 l/ha (35,707 US gal/ac) more.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 11.8° higher in Aragarcas than in Encruz. Do Sul.
  • Relative humidity levels are 3.6%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 6.3°C (11.3°F) higher.
